Are people in Driggs older or younger than people in Sparta?- The Median Age in Driggs is 8.7 years younger than in Sparta.
Are housing costs cheaper in Driggs or Sparta?- Driggs
housing costs are 173.2% more expensive than Sparta hous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Driggs or Sparta?- The average commute for residents of Driggs is 9.7 minutes longer than it is for residents of Sparta.

Things to do in Driggs?Living in Driggs, Idaho is a unique experience and one that many people enjoy. The town is located in the foothills of the Teton Mountains and offers breathtaking views of the surrounding area as well as easy access to Jackson Hole, Wyoming. The area provides a peaceful atmosphere with plenty of outdoor activities such as camping, fishing, hiking, skiing and snowmobiling. There are also many cultural attractions in Driggs including an annual winter carnival and an old fashioned rodeo. The town has a variety of restaurants and shops to explore downtown, making it an ideal spot for both locals and visitors alike.
